Needham & Company Reiterates Buy on The Trade Desk, Inc. (TTD) Following 3Q Report
November 11, 2016 8:42 AM ESTNeedham & Company reiterated a Buy rating and $32.00 price target on The Trade Desk, Inc. (NASDAQ: TTD) following the company's 3Q earnings report. The company reported revenue of $53.0M, above the consensus of $49.1M. The company reported strong profitability with Q3 adjusted EBITDA of $16.6M, a 31.3% EBITDA... More
RBC Capital Reiterates Outperform on The Trade Desk, Inc. (TTD) Following Strong 3Q
November 11, 2016 7:08 AM ESTRBC Capital maintained an Outperform rating and $33.00 price target on The Trade Desk, Inc. (NASDAQ: TTD) following the company's 3Q earnings report. Revenue of $53.0MM beat the Street's estimates of $49.1MM with the company highlighting greater than expected election ad spend and a... More

The Trade Desk (TTD) Tops Q3 EPS by 3c
November 10, 2016 4:05 PM ESTThe Trade Desk (NASDAQ: TTD) reported Q3 EPS of $0.24, $0.03 better than the analyst estimate of $0.21. Revenue for the quarter came in at $53 million versus the consensus estimate of $49.06 million.
